Dumpster Dimension Choices



For picking the best dumpster size, it's vital to have a good understanding of the available alternatives. Dumpster sizes usually range from 10 to 40 cubic lawns, with variants in between.

A 10-yard dumpster appropriates for little projects like a garage cleanout or a tiny improvement. If you're dealing with a medium-sized job such as a kitchen remodel or a cellar cleanout, a 20-yard dumpster could be the best option.

For bigger jobs like a whole-house restoration or commercial construction, a 30 or 40-yard dumpster could be more suitable to fit the volume of waste created.

When deciding on a dumpster dimension, think about the amount and kind of debris you expect to deal with. It's better to select a slightly larger dimension if you're uncertain to prevent overfilling. Keep in mind, it's even more affordable to rent a dumpster that fits your needs rather than having to order an additional one.

Matching Dimension to Job



Optimally matching the dumpster size to your project is essential for efficient waste management. To establish the appropriate dimension, take into consideration the scope and nature of your job.

For tiny household cleanouts or remodellings, a 10-yard dumpster might suffice. These are typically 12 feet long and can hold about 4 pickup truck lots of waste.

For bigger jobs like renovating multiple rooms or cleaning out a huge estate, a 20-yard dumpster could be better. These are around 22 feet long and can hold roughly 8 pickup lots.

If you're tackling a significant building and construction task or industrial renovation, a 30-yard dumpster could be the very best fit. These dumpsters have to do with 22 feet long and can suit about 12 pickup truck lots of particles.



Matching the dumpster size to your job guarantees you have adequate area for all waste materials without paying too much for extra ability.
